#ifndef RESULT_SET_UTILS_H
#define RESULT_SET_UTILS_H
#include "ringtone_log.h"
#include "ringtone_type.h"
namespace OHOS {
namespace Media {
#define EXPORT __attribute__ ((visibility ("default")))
class ResultSetUtils {
public:
template<typename T>
static std::variant<int32_t, std::string, int64_t, double> GetValFromColumn(const std::string &columnName,
T &resultSet, RingtoneResultSetDataType type)
{
if (resultSet == nullptr) {
RINGTONE_ERR_LOG("resultSet is nullptr");
return DefaultVariantVal(type);
}
int32_t err;
int32_t index = 0;
err = resultSet->GetColumnIndex(columnName, index);
if (err) {
RINGTONE_ERR_LOG("get column index err %{public}d", err);
return DefaultVariantVal(type);
}
std::variant<int32_t, std::string, int64_t, double> data;
switch (type) {
case RingtoneResultSetDataType::DATA_TYPE_STRING: {
data = GetStringValFromColumn(index, resultSet);
break;
}
case RingtoneResultSetDataType::DATA_TYPE_INT32: {
data = GetIntValFromColumn(index, resultSet);
break;
}
case RingtoneResultSetDataType::DATA_TYPE_INT64: {
data = GetLongValFromColumn(index, resultSet);
break;
}
case RingtoneResultSetDataType::DATA_TYPE_DOUBLE: {
data = GetDoubleValFromColumn(index, resultSet);
break;
}
default: {
break;
}
}
return data;
}
template<typename T>
static inline std::string GetStringValFromColumn(int index, T &resultSet)
{
std::string stringVal;
if (resultSet->GetString(index, stringVal)) {
return "";
}
return stringVal;
}
template<typename T>
static inline int32_t GetIntValFromColumn(int index, T &resultSet)
{
int32_t integerVal;
if (resultSet->GetInt(index, integerVal)) {
return 0;
}
return integerVal;
}
template<typename T>
static inline int64_t GetLongValFromColumn(int index, T &resultSet)
{
int64_t integer64Val;
if (resultSet->GetLong(index, integer64Val)) {
return 0;
}
return integer64Val;
}
template<typename T>
static inline double GetDoubleValFromColumn(int index, T &resultSet)
{
double doubleVal;
if (resultSet->GetDouble(index, doubleVal)) {
return 0;
}
return doubleVal;
}
private:
static std::variant<int32_t, std::string, int64_t, double> DefaultVariantVal(RingtoneResultSetDataType type)
{
switch (type) {
case RingtoneResultSetDataType::DATA_TYPE_STRING:
return std::string();
case RingtoneResultSetDataType::DATA_TYPE_INT32:
return 0;
case RingtoneResultSetDataType::DATA_TYPE_INT64:
return static_cast<int64_t>(0);
case RingtoneResultSetDataType::DATA_TYPE_DOUBLE:
return static_cast<double>(0);
default:
RINGTONE_ERR_LOG("invalid data type %{public}d", type);
}
return 0;
}
};
template<typename ResultSet>
static inline std::string GetStringVal(const std::string &field, const ResultSet &result)
{
return std::get<std::string>(ResultSetUtils::GetValFromColumn(field, result, DATA_TYPE_STRING));
}
template<typename ResultSet>
static inline int32_t GetInt32Val(const std::string &field, const ResultSet &result)
{
return std::get<int32_t>(ResultSetUtils::GetValFromColumn(field, result, DATA_TYPE_INT32));
}
template<typename ResultSet>
static inline int64_t GetInt64Val(const std::string &field, const ResultSet &result)
{
return std::get<int64_t>(ResultSetUtils::GetValFromColumn(field, result, DATA_TYPE_INT64));
}
}
}
#endif
